I love the color yellow and how it makes me feel so I had a quick search about it on the internet and found out a little more about it .....

Yellow symbolizes: wisdom, joy, happiness and intellectual energy.
Put some yellow in your life when you want clarity for decision-making, relief from 'burnout', panic, nervousness, exhaustion. It also aids sharper memory and concentration skills and gives protection from lethargy and depression during dull weather.
On the downside ......people lose their tempers more often in yellow rooms, and babies will cry more. It is the most difficult color for the eye to take in, so it can be overpowering if overused..... so I won't be painting a whole room yellow!!!
